The estate

Founded in 1750, Chanson is one of the most famous estates in Burgundy. The estate is located in a watchtower-like bastion, built in the early 16th century, with 8-metre thick walls, nicknamed "La Tour des Filles" and now used to house the wines during the ageing period. Well-known by lovers of fine Burgundian wines, the Chanson Père & Fils estate offers secret vintages that brilliantly reveal the expression of the finest wine-producing villages in the Côte de Beaune.

Domaine Chanson covers 45 hectares of vines in the most beautiful appellations of the Côte de Beaune (Santenay, Chassagne-Montrachet, Puligny-Montrachet, Beaune, Savigny-Les-Beaune, Corton...), exclusively in Premiers and Grands Crus.

The vineyard

The Chanson estate owns a 4.3-hectare plot on the iconic Clos des Mouches vineyard and grows 2.5 hectares of Pinot Noir. Situated on clay-limestone marl soils, the Clos des Mouches is one of the fine Beaune wines. Close to the Pommard Premiers Crus, the Clos des Mouches benefits from a superb sun exposure and is south-east facing, resulting in wines with a radiant and generous identity.

The vintage

A classic winter preceded a spring whose high temperatures were offset by a cold period at the beginning of April, which slowed down the development of the vines. The summer was particularly hot and was marked by thunderstorms that salvaged the vineyard. The vineyard was in perfect health and the weather conditions during the harvest, which began on September 6th, were equally perfect.

The vinification and ageing

Fermentation in whole bunches for two weeks. The wine is aged for 14 to 18 months in the 16th century Bastion, with a moderate proportion of new barrels.

The blend

Pinot Noir (100%).

Domaine Chanson’s 2017 Beaune 1er cru "Clos des Mouches": Characteristics and tasting tips

The tasting

Colour

Theis wine is a dark red colour.

Nose

Complex, the nose mixes floral fragrances (lilac) with delicious fruity and spicy notes.

Palate

Full and lively, the mouth seduces with its defined texture, its silky tannins and its beautiful persistence.

Food and wine pairing

The Beaune 1er cru "Clos des Mouches" 2017 by Domaine Chanson will pair with marinated red meats, dishes served with a sauce (boeuf bourguignon) or cheeses (Brillat-Savarin) beautifully.
